Looking for information on what Native American tribes may have been in the St. Sylvestre, St Agathe areas of Quebec. Also looking for information on Lewis Conn and Mary Laughery. Know that Mary may have been Indian. Don't know if her last name was changed to Laughery from something similiar. They did have some children born in the St. Agathe and St Sylvestre area. Bridget born in St. Sylvestre married William Dexter....Mary A. born in St. Agathe married Albert LaDoo, James born in Canada married Irena Paschal, Ralph born in Vermont married Alita Moore. We have been told that Mary was full blooded Abenaki Indian but can't find a connection (Laughery doesn't sound Indian to me) Other children, Charlie, Elizabeth, Sarah married Fred Lawrence, Catherine married Thomas Liberty, Annie married William Kennedy.
